Description
A comforting one-skillet supper featuring crispy chicken, garlicky rice, and mixed vegetables, ready in under 30 minutes.
Ingredients
- 2 chicken breasts, diced (about 1 lb / 450 g)
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 1 tablespoon vegetable oil
- 2 cups cooked rice (white or brown)
- 1 cup mixed vegetables (peas, carrots, corn)
- 4 cloves garlic, minced
- 2 tablespoons soy sauce
- Green onions, chopped (for garnish)
Instructions
- Prep everything first. Have your diced chicken, minced garlic, cooked rice, and mixed vegetables ready to go.
- Heat the skillet. In a large skillet, heat 1 tablespoon vegetable oil over medium heat until shimmering.
- Cook the chicken. Add the diced chicken, season with salt and pepper, and cook until golden and cooked through, about 5–7 minutes.
- Add the garlic. Push the chicken to one side of the pan, add the minced garlic to the empty space, and stir for about 1 minute until fragrant.
- Stir in the rice and soy sauce. Mix well for 1–2 minutes so the rice heats through and absorbs the savory sauce.
- Add vegetables and finish. Add the mixed vegetables and cook for 3–4 minutes until heated through, adjusting seasoning as needed.
Notes
Use cold, day-old rice for best results. Feel free to adjust garlic and soy sauce levels to taste. For added brightness, serve with lime.
